She was definitely under prepared for going home. If the hospital was suffocating, this was beyond strangling. Apparently Dedrick, Rehida, Orida, Connor and Iyla had become some sort of parenting team against Thalia and Koin, deciding together what was best for the two of them.

She wasn’t upset by the little Cabin they had set up for them, it was actually perfect and beautiful. It was all dark wood on the outside, green shingles on the roof and shutters to match, even the door was green as well. It was 1 floor, 1 bedroom with an open kitchen and living room that merged, only half separated by a long island bar. The inside was simple as well, dark wood to match the outside, but with bold accents of yellow and white to make it feel a little bigger. The furniture was all in either leather or black, and she could Rehidas touches everywhere, not just visually, but because Iyla was so excited to detail their shopping trip.
